"Typical beautiful Queen Anne street"
Just high enough on the hill to give most homes and apartments at least a peek-a-boo view of the Seattle skyline, Ward Street is one of the greenest on Queen Anne hill. Separated by a mini greenbelt, Ward Street provides one-way traffic to both sides of the neighborhood and very tight on-street parking in that section of the road. The neighborhood is quiet and green, the neighbors are friendly and traffic is very light. A short walk takes you to some fabulous restaurants, shopping and Seattle Center, where you can hop the monorail to downtown.

"Great street, minutes from downtown"
Ward Street has sweeping views of the Seattle skyline, and the Space Needle looms in every backyard and porch. A well kept park with plenty of kid-friendly equipment abuts the street at 5th. Mere blocks away are a dry cleaner, convenience store, greats bars, restaurants of various types, a grocery store, drugstore, etc...yet the street itself feels as though it's in a neighborhood, not a city!
